Fairy dreams can be enchanting, whimsical, and sometimes a bit mischievous. In these dreams, fairies often symbolize magic, transformation, and the playful aspects of life. They can represent your inner child or a desire for freedom and creativity. When you dream of a fairy, it may reflect your longing for joy and spontaneity in your waking life.

Different Cultures, Different Meanings

In Western cultures, fairies often symbolize magic and creativity, reflecting a desire for freedom. In East Asian traditions, they may represent harmony and balance in relationships. South Asian folklore often portrays fairies as guardians of nature, emphasizing family connections.

Middle Eastern stories depict fairies as protectors, highlighting community values and approval. In Latin American cultures, fairies symbolize loyalty and romantic ideals, often linked to love stories. African traditions blend urban and traditional views, portraying fairies as symbols of hope and resilience.

Psychological Perspectives

From a Freudian perspective, dreaming of a fairy may represent repressed desires or childhood memories. This dream could indicate a longing for innocence and playfulness.

Jungian analysts might interpret fairy dreams as archetypes of transformation and creativity. The fairy symbolizes the potential for personal growth and change.

The continuity hypothesis suggests that fairy dreams reflect waking life experiences and emotions. If you feel stressed or anxious, these dreams may serve as a coping mechanism, helping you process your feelings.
